Sdílet prostřednictvím


CMonthCalCtrl::GetMonthRange

Načte data představující vysoké a nízké limity řízení kalendářní měsíc zobrazení informací.

int GetMonthRange(
   COleDateTime& refMinRange,
   COleDateTime& refMaxRange,
   DWORD dwFlags 
) const;
int GetMonthRange(
   CTime& refMinRange,
   CTime& refMaxRange,
   DWORD dwFlags 
) const;
int GetMonthRange(
   LPSYSTEMTIME pMinRange,
   LPSYSTEMTIME pMaxRange,
   DWORD dwFlags 
) const;

Parametry

  • refMinRange
    Odkaz na COleDateTime nebo CTime objekt obsahující minimální povolené datum.

  • refMaxRange
    Odkaz na COleDateTime nebo CTime objekt obsahující maximální povolené datum.

  • pMinRange
    Ukazatel SYSTEMTIME struktury obsahující datum na konci nejnižší rozsah.

  • pMaxRange
    Ukazatel SYSTEMTIME struktury obsahující datum na konci nejvyšší rozsah.

  • dwFlags
    Hodnota určující rozsah omezení rozsahu mají být načteny.Tato hodnota musí být jeden z následujících.

    Value

    Význam

    GMR_DAYSTATE

    Zahrnout předchozí a na konci měsíce viditelné oblasti, které jsou zobrazeny pouze částečně.

    GMR_VISIBLE

    Zahrnout pouze měsíce, které jsou zcela zobrazeny.

Vrácená hodnota

Celé číslo, které představuje oblast, v měsících, rozložené ve dvou limity označeny refMinRange a refMaxRange v první a druhé verze, nebo pMinRange a pMaxRange ve třetí verzi.

Poznámky

Členské funkce implementuje chování zprávy Win32 MCM_GETMONTHRANGE, jak je popsáno v .MFC a provádění GetMonthRange , můžete určit COleDateTime využití, CTime využití, nebo SYSTEMTIME struktury využití.

Příklad

Příklad pro CMonthCalCtrl::SetDayState.

Požadavky

Záhlaví: afxdtctl.h

Viz také

Referenční dokumentace

Třída CMonthCalCtrl

Diagram hierarchie

CMonthCalCtrl::GetRange